Dear Rosario,Using SPIS-DUST (now downloadable on the SPIS website) you can get the moments of the surface distributions if you set (or add) the Global parameter momentsMonitoringFlag=1. From density and velocity of the collected ions, you can get the force you want.Regards,Sébastien

Hello,I am simulating an object situated inside the plume of a thruster. I would like to obtain the force that is exerted on the object. Is there any way to do so with SPIS, directly or indirectly (ion pressure maps or something similar)?
I would also like to track the ions that are backstreaming towards my S/C. In which way is this done? I have activated the sourceTrajFlag, but I am not clear on how this is visualized.Thank you very much in advance,
